
Joan Orleans
Born in New Orleans and grown up in Baton Rouge, the capital of Louisiana, Joan Orleans, daughter of a married couple of teachers, spent her youth in the USA. In New Orleans, where the Blues and the grand Gospel singings are rooted in deeply, she started her career as a vocalist. \r Discovered and brought forward by her uncle, a banjo player from the French Quarter in New Orleans, music remained just her hobby. After her graduation from high school, Joan Orleans studied arts an dramatics at the Southern\r University of Baton Rouge. Having finished her studies the singer met her luxembourgian husband and manager Marcel Schmitt, along with whom she relocated to europe.\r The Soul-Lady become known in germany in a flash through the TV show "Bio's Bahnhof". Alfred Biolek at once recognized the entertainer's exceeding voice volume and promtly engaged her. Subsequently Joan Orleans was able to give proof of her incomparable musicality in numerous TV performances.
